Hi, for 2 months i m doing the project of RC car with massive standing on Aerodynamics that i m testing in CFD, i may have wrong question for that forum but maybye someone will help me there. However i have the results of simulation that amazed me. My car that is about 70cm long and without any spoilers and undertray the car is generating a lift force about 16N. Car with undertray but still with no spoilers have a vertical vorce about 0.004 N with a return upward. The same model but with spoilers generate more LIFT FORCE (about 0.1) that making me crazy because in simulation where i tested only the spoilers the results was a downforce about 5.4 N. So there is some mistake or mistakes that i definitely doing but i dont have any idea what may be wrong with it. I added screens of simulation results without any devices in car (aIRSHARD _ BEZ AEROPACKU.PNG), only with undertray (AFTER.PNG), with full aerodynamics (NOLIDEEEE,JPG) may that results may tell someone more than me. With the current settings, you will be not able to get reasonable results. The air volume around the car is too small, probably the mesh also will be rather not the best one. In that situation, the forces generated by the fluid could be far from the real ones and be more or less random.

Here you have some information about the outside volume and BC. I will also set the floor BC as velocity in the Y direction. In reality, the car is driving on the road, not on the road 🙂

Aerodynamics simulation require also very fine mesh and a proper turbulence model.

Here you have more information.

After the meshing, you will get a lot of elements, so if that is possible, please cut the model in half and apply symmetry BC.
